    Colt SCW Sub-Compact Weapon at Arms Unlimited?

    I was looking at Arms Unlimited and noticed that they added the Colt SCW Sub-Compact Weapon folding stock assembly kit to their offerings.
    https://armsunlimited.com/firearms/?...rand=67&page=1

    I then noticed that they're now also offering a Colt SCW Sub-Compact Weapon 5.56mm Semi-Auto 10.3" Barrel CQB Rifle.
    https://armsunlimited.com/colt-scw-s...rel-cqb-rifle/
    The SCW0921 sku number matches Colt's sku number. However, there are a few things that don't seem right. First, there is no bayo lug. Second, the flash hider doesn't match what's shown on Colt's website. Third, receiver isn't marked SCW Carbine like in the picture shown on the rtgparts.com website.


    Am I correct in thinking that these were pieced together after they left the factory? Arms Unlimited does get some unique stuff from Colt, but they once sold me a pieced together LE901-16SE. The only way I found out was that it wouldn't fire, so I called Colt and they told me that the receiver left the factory as a spare part. Arms Unlimited did take it back, but I'm now pretty suspicious of them.

    My bet is that they took an LE6945 and then put a SCW stock kit on it, thereby making a SCW. Based on their prices, you saved $203 versus buying them separately, but they kept the original bolt and a few other parts. I think this is one of those opportunities that's here for a while and then gone forever. Since I already have a LE6945, I just bought the SCW stock kit and will put it on myself.

    They offer the same SCW kit on a M5, but so far as I can tell that was never a real offering from Colt. Colt does offer the 10.3" M5 with a different SCW kit, but I've never seen that one available.
